SENATE BILL NO. 116
BY SENATOR JACKSON-ANDREW S AND REPRESENTATIVE KNOX 
1	AN ACT
2 To amend and reenact Code of Criminal Procedure Art. 978(A)(2) and 992 and to enact
3 Code of Criminal Procedure Art. 978(F), relative to expungement of records; to
4 provide for the expungement of a felony record with another felony conviction
5 during the ten-year cleansing period under certain circumstances; to provide relative
6 to expungement forms; and to provide for related matters.
7 Be it enacted by the Legislature of Louisiana:
8 Section 1. Code of Criminal Procedure Art. 978(A)(2) and 992 are hereby amended
9 and reenacted and Code of Criminal Procedure Art. 978(F) is hereby enacted to read as
10 follows:
11 Art. 978. Motion to expunge record of arrest and conviction of a felony offense
12	A. Except as provided in Paragraph B of this Article, a person may file a
13 motion to expunge his record of arrest and conviction of a felony offense if any of
14 the following apply:
15	*          *          *
16	(2) More than ten years have elapsed since the person completed any
17 sentence, deferred adjudication, or period of probation or parole based on the felony
18 conviction, and the person has not been convicted of any other criminal offense
19 during the ten-year for a period, of at least ten years preceding the motion and has
20 no criminal charge pending against him. The motion filed pursuant to this
21 Subparagraph shall include a certification obtained from the district attorney which
22 verifies that, to his knowledge, the applicant has no convictions during the ten-year
23 period immediately preceding the motion, and no pending charges under a bill of
24 information or indictment.

2	F. A person shall be eligible to have more than one felony conviction
3 expunged in a ten-year period if each felony is eligible for expungement under
4 the provisions of this Article.
